Start with Santa’s classic red suit. Use a bright red for his coat and pants, and don’t forget the white trim for his cuffs and hat. His belt is usually black with a gold buckle, and his boots are black too. For his rosy cheeks and nose, light pink or red adds a fun touch. And of course, give him a fluffy white beard—maybe even a little sparkle if you’re using glitter!
